bigcommerce custom checkout


Use the local server address thats provided by npm run dev:server to go to your BigCommerce test store.

The following are the requirements you should have in your system to check out the feature: 1)First step is to clone the repository from GitHub. The Checkout SDK allows you to have a high degree of control over presentation, but it must be used on the native storefront. It takes a lot of time and money just to get people to visit your site. According to the BigCommerce Terms of Use, if you edit your checkout pages code, you will then be responsible for maintaining PCI compliance. Perhaps the best default BigCommerce checkout feature for your sales figures is persistent cart, which makes it so that when a visitor adds an item to their cart on one device, this change is reflected on their other devices as well. huckleberry According to Bolt, the benefits of their checkout solution including: BigCommerce customers can begin using Bolts checkout now. If you edit your code with BigCommerce Open Checkout, youll then need to host your checkout page yourself. This custom checkout was built by Intuit Solutions on the BigCommerce Checkout SDK for Bohemian Traders. Transform your store into a headless commerce progressive web app.

5) Your next step is to just copy the /dist folder and paste it into the checkout folder that you have just created above in your WebDAV. At BigCommerce, we go to great lengths to make sure our platform meets these security standards. Here are a variety of customizations you can build: It is important to note that the Checkout SDK does not allow you to change the underpinnings of the checkout. Split the terminal. Although there are many good reasons for customizing the checkout page, the consequences of introducing bugs are significant. Earlier in BigCommerce, the only way to edit the optimized one-page checkout provided by BigCommerce was to implement checkout SDK, which does not replicate all the features of BigCommerce checkout. The Checkout SDK can also provide a checkout solution for remote headless storefronts, if you redirect back to the BigCommerce domain for the checkout step. Its always a good idea to check for a setting before hard-coding CSS, because it gives merchants more control over their design and ensures their choices persist through theme updates. This custom checkout was built by Bolt using the Checkout SDK for Kettlebell Kings. Our philosophy is that merchants should be able to look to the Optimized One-Page Checkout as an example of best practices in checkout form design, but we also want to build as much openness into our checkout as possible to accommodate merchants with specific business needs who are able to take on the effort of advanced customization. Now, there are three columns on the checkout page. Now that weve covered some of the standard customizations you might want to make to checkout, lets get into the more advanced options. Security is also a consideration. The Checkout SDK is a JavaScript library that makes it easy to consume the new Checkout APIs. obituary fake clipping obit newspapers personalized The process for converting a cart to an order follows this flow: Although there is quite a bit of flexibility in what you can customize on the checkout page, theres one important thing to keep in mind.

Use the following steps: Command : npm installnpm ci`. Beyond that, you have the ability to reference a custom stylesheet or add your own CSS rules to manipulate styles and layout. Along with that flexibility comes a heavier development lift, and because you are building and hosting the form that will accept credit card information, responsibility for making sure the checkout is PCI compliant. From upgrading your website with the latest versions to extending maintenance and support, we augment your business to meet customer demands and drive revenue. He is currently working on Bigcommerce and as an avid learner, he constantly strives to expand his knowledge base. Plus, this gives BigCommerce merchants even more control in their desired ecommerce checkout experience, along with the ease of use of a one-click install. Understand headless commerce without all the jargon. Because the checkout page is on the BigCommerce domain and isnt modified by external code, BigCommerce PCI compliance can extend to the remote storefronts checkout. Open Checkout is an improvement on the SDK that allows developers to make changes in much less time. Something went wrong while submitting the form. There are even some basic cosmetic changes you can make to your checkout page from the standard BigCommerce interface. Stay tuned! In his free time, you can find him watching political debates and YouTube to learn new technologies. Once you complete your local, you can start developing with it. Youll also need to confirm that your Node is greater than version 10 and npm is greater than version 3. The SDK handles all the heavy-lifting such as: Beyond general availability of the Checkout SDK, BigCommerce is also proud to announce and showcase multiple customers using a customized checkout via the Checkout SDK and two BigCommerce partners who have built out ready-to-use customized checkout applications. For example, you can change the background color, change the font thats used in your headings, upload images for your logo and header, etc. Beyond customization for brands, agencies, developers and technology companies now have the ability to build a completely customized checkout on BigCommerce, and then market that solution as a replacement for the BigCommerce checkout on both the BigCommerce App Store and their own marketing material. First, you need to pull in the dependencies required for the application using the below command: You can make changes to the source code after that and run the following command to build it: You could upload a Custom Checkout to your stores server using WebDAV. Embedded checkout is a great solution for a remote headless storefront, because shoppers can complete their purchase in-context, without being redirected to a BigCommerce domain. Learn everything about headless commerce and crafting exceptional experiences. The Store Design editor provides an interface for controlling settings like the checkout pages header image, colors, and fonts. Note: While our engineering team is mindful of keeping DOM elements and classes consistent, we cannot guarantee that element IDs will never change across future updates. The best practice for running custom scripts on the checkout page is to avoid interacting with the checkout code directly, and these instructions are provided as a consideration for developers who have weighed the risk. With a better design, you could be converting many of the people who otherwise would have abandoned their cart into customers. Another benefit to BigCommerces native checkout is that its PCI-compliant by default. 2)Next you will need to select Checkout Type, go ahead and select Custom Checkouts. But with Open Checkout, you can take this customization to the next level and edit every single pixel of the default checkout. Yellow is going through a complete digital transformation and bringing a whole new set of services online. Delivering the best-in-class customer experience is more vital than ever in the eCommerce space. with our experts to learn more about our eCommerce services and product suite. Apply to join the Shogun Agency Partner Program. Enter the command "npm install && npm ci" to install all the necessary packages.

2)From your store control panel, navigate to Server Settings > File Access (WebDAV).3)Once you connect the WebDAV, the next thing would be to enter the /content folder and create a new folder named checkout.4) Open the /dist folder from your Checkout Code.5) Your next step is to just copy the /dist folder and paste it into the checkout folder that you have just created above in your WebDAV. You can work in React, Angular, Vue, or even just plain HTML and JavaScriptwhichever frontend framework you prefer to build in. The Server-to-Server (S2S) Checkout API allows developers to orchestrate a checkout on a remote server. We worked with BigCommerce partner Intuit Solutions, which puts a skin over the BigCommerce one page checkout and rearranges all of the information, says David Berlach, CEO of Bohemian Traders. Now, use the local address along with auto-loader-dev.js which is present under /build/ directory. Clone your fork and start working locally. In November 2020, BigCommerce launched Open Checkout.

There, you can find documentation, installation instructions, and take a look at the code. There are a number of reasons why you might want to do this, such as: Before you start using BigCommerce Open Checkout to tinker with your site, there are a few things you should consider. huckleberry The Optimized One-page Checkout is a single page application whose purpose is to convert a Cart to an Order. There is no scrolling at all. At BigCommerce, weve put a lot of research behind our flagship checkout page, Optimized One-Page Checkout, and its designed to create a checkout experience that will streamline the purchase process and increase conversions for merchants across the platform. Remember when we talked about the layers that make up the Optimized One-page checkout? 1901 E Palm Valley BlvdSuite 109Round Rock, TX 78664, Copyright 2022 DCKAP Inc. All rights reserved, This blog will let you know how to edit the Checkout page in, 1)First step is to clone the repository from. We could do the following, which checks for an element with the ID #checkoutBillingAddress. No Noise. Now since you have all the requirements listed above in your system to start with, setting up your local environment is the next step. Here are two companies already building additional revenue with BigCommerces Checkout SDK. Create a Map with Directions in MapQuest and React JS. Anything that affects checkout page uptime is going to have a direct impact on a stores sales. boba fett pvc